在HTML代码中,超链接元素的标记是什么?

上周,我那个朋友问我HTML里超链接怎么弄。
我说,你看,就是用这个标签,然后加个href属性,比如百度知道。
他问什么是href,我就跟他说,这就像锚,锚定链接的目的地。

2 02 3 年,我发现他还不太懂,我就解释了两种用法:一种是通过href指向另一个文档,另一种是通过name或id属性在文档内部创建书签。
他说,哦,那我知道了,就是锚点。

我还跟他说,这个href属性很重要,它决定了链接去哪里。
然后我又提到了浏览器默认的链接颜色,他说,哦,原来是这样。

我刚想到另一件事,你还可以用CSS改变链接的样式,比如用伪类。
比如这样写:a:link { color: FF0000; },就是设置未访问链接的颜色。

他听了,说,这太方便了。
我笑了笑,说,是啊,网页设计就是要这样灵活。
你看着办,想学就学,不想学也行。

HTML超链接使用:如何添加跳转链接的详细步骤

哈喽,你问我超链接怎么弄啊?行,我给你捋捋,都是我踩坑总结出来的。

上周有个客人问我,为啥他加了个链接,点过去页面就乱码了... 哦豁,估计是没搞对路径或者忘了加 https。
我直接跟他讲,超链接这玩意儿,用 a 标签就行,但里面的道道可多了。

最基础的文本链接,这谁不会啊?
你看我之前发的那个文档链接,就是直接这么用的:
访问示例网站
简单吧?就是用 把你想变成链接的文本包起来,href 后面跟上目标网址就行。
点 "访问示例网站" 就能跳转了,这没啥好说的。

但是!新标签打开怎么弄?
现在谁用手机看网页啊,链接一多全堆在当前页面,翻半天还全打乱了。
所以,新标签打开是标配。
以前我老犯迷糊,不知道加 target="_blank" 就行,结果有时候在新标签里点链接,还能被人家通过 window.opener 窃取信息,太吓人了!
现在我知道了,必须加 target="_blank",还得带上 rel="noopener noreferrer"。
这俩加一起,安全性能都搞定了。
看这个例子:
在新窗口打开
这样点链接就会在新标签页里跳转,而且对方没法通过 window.opener 来干坏事。
这点,我去年在一个项目里差点就踩坑了,幸亏同事提醒了我。

链接到网站内部文件,相对路径是关键!
比如你的网站结构是:
yoursite/ ├── index. ├── about. └── files/ └── report.docx
如果你在 index. 里想链接到 about.,直接写 就行,浏览器会自动找到同级的 about.。
但如果要链接到 files 目录下的 report.docx,就得写成 ,浏览器会提示你下载或者预览(如果支持的话)。

相对路径的好处太大了!假设你把整个网站从 http 换成 https,或者把文件都挪到别的服务器了,你只需要改根目录下的那些绝对路径链接,像 ,其他的同级或子目录链接都自动跟着变,不用一个个改,省事多了。
我之前帮朋友改网站协议的时候,就是靠这个,不然那几万条链接得改到猴年马月去。

页面内锚点跳转,简直是长文档救星!
有时候文章太长,读者得一直往下划。
这时候锚点就派上用场了。
操作步骤我之前发文档里写得很清楚了: 1 . 先给目标位置(比如一个 h2 标题)加个 id,像这样:

第一部分

2 . 然后在文章开头或其他地方加一个链接:跳转至第一部分 点这个链接,页面就会自动滚动到你加 id 的地方。
这个我经常用,比如我之前那个操作手册文档,里面各种章节的跳转全靠锚点。

图片也能当链接用!
这个其实很简单,就是把 标签包在 标签里就行:

就像广告图、按钮那种,图片自带点击效果,用户体验好。
不过要注意,图片要加上 alt 属性,这样如果有人用屏幕阅读器,也能知道这是啥。
我之前有个客户网站,图片链接没加 alt,结果被朋友吐槽,说体验不好,哈哈。

总结一下关键点:
基本链接:文本 新标签打开:文本 内部文件用相对路径,方便维护 页面内定位用锚点,加id名 图片链接记得加 alt
你看,超链接没那么神秘,关键点记住了,基本就能搞定了。
不过安全这块,特别是 target="_blank" + rel="..." 这点,一定要记牢,现在安全越来越重要了。

你还有其他问题吗?比如具体某个场景怎么用?或者看到某个奇怪的链接想问我为啥这样写?都可以直接问,我把我知道的都告诉你。

HTML表格链接怎么添加_HTML表格中添加超链接方法

哎哟,说起来,在HTML表格里加个超链接,其实就跟给手机里加个快捷方式似的简单。
你就是在表格的单元格里(不管是td还是th)放个标签,然后告诉它想去哪,就像这样:
示例链接 新窗口打开

这其中的target="_blank"就像是说“别在这页打开,去新标签页吧”,挺有用的,尤其是链接到别的网站的时候。

但啊,这事儿也有讲究,比如你不能用那种模糊不清的链接文字,得具体,就像“查看智能手机X详情”这样的。
还有啊,默认的链接样式有时候和你的表格风格不搭,就得自己改改。

那常见的问题呢,比如链接文字不够具体,或者样式冲突,或者嵌套了不该嵌套的东西。
这都得注意,要不是屏幕阅读器读起来不舒服,要不是看起来乱糟糟的。

要想高级一点,你可以根据链接的类型来决定它怎么打开,是当前页还是新标签页。
还能整行点击,跳转到链接,这得用到点JavaScript。

说到性能优化,大数据量的表格就得用虚拟滚动,就是只渲染用户能看到的行,其他的不渲染,节省内存。
还有事件委托,就是不用给每个链接单独绑定事件,而是用一个大的事件处理器来管理,这样也能节省资源。

最后呢,链接生成得规范,要么后端生成,要么前端根据数据动态生成,再用data-属性来存储参数,这样管理起来也方便。

总的来说,表格里的链接加得对,不仅能让人用着舒服,还能提高性能。